1
burn until it becomes charred
To burn something so it becomes black and charred.
Gebruikspatroon:
carbonize [something]
Veelgemaakte fout:
Do not confuse carbonize (burn/char) with carbonate (make fizzy or form a carbonate).

3
convert organic matter to carbon
To heat a material so it becomes mostly carbon.
Gebruikspatroon:
carbonize [material] (at/in/under [temperature/conditions])
Veelgemaakte fout:
Carbonize is not the same as incinerate; incinerate burns to ash, while carbonize often means controlled heating that leaves carbon.
Synoniemen
pyrolyze (More technical; specifically heating in the absence of oxygen.)
|
char (Often used for the resulting effect; less explicit about controlled processing.)
